Perfect Squares and Cubes
To simplify square roots and cube roots, you must recognize perfect squares and perfect cubes. Use this Warm Up as a refresher of perfect squares and cubes. Mark the page so that it is easily accessible, and be sure to practice enough questions so that these become sufficiently familiar.
